[quote=Anonymous]We did it, but it helped that the original brick wa already painted, so all we had to worry about was matching the texture, not the color. It added significantly to the cost (that, plus we added a full-on masonry fireplace). We love it and think it helped the addition feel seamless. We are actually selling the house in the Spring to move to a much larger new construction house. As the move gets closer, I honestly think we will really miss the old house. We did the addition right with all high quality stuff and we are not sure the new house will ever compare favorably to the old one (except for the space). It really comes down to what you care about and the vibe of the house. I'm quite sure no one is going to pay for what we put into our addition, although overall our house will show really, really well. People comment on how great our house is all the time. Sniff.
